diff --git a/meta/classes/reproducible_build.bbclass b/meta/classes/reproducible_build.bbclass deleted file mode 100644 index 8788ad7145..0000000000 --- a/meta/classes/reproducible_build.bbclass +++ /dev/null @@ -1,170 +0,0 @@ -# reproducible_build.bbclass -# -# Sets SOURCE_DATE_EPOCH in each component's build environment. -# Upstream components (generally) respect this environment variable, -# using it in place of the "current" date and time. -# See https://reproducible-builds.org/specs/source-date-epoch/ -# -# After sources are unpacked but before they are patched, we set a reproducible value for SOURCE_DATE_EPOCH. -# This value should be reproducible for anyone who builds the same revision from the same sources. -# -# There are 4 ways we determine SOURCE_DATE_EPOCH: -# -# 1. Use the value from __source_date_epoch.txt file if this file exists. -# This file was most likely created in the previous build by one of the following methods 2,3,4. -# Alternatively, it can be provided by a recipe via SRC_URI. -# -# If the file does not exist: -# -# 2. If there is a git checkout, use the last git commit timestamp. -# Git does not preserve file timestamps on checkout. -# -# 3. Use the mtime of "known" files such as NEWS, CHANGLELOG, ... -# This works for well-kept repositories distributed via tarball. -# -# 4. Use the modification time of the youngest file in the source tree, if there is one. -# This will be the newest file from the distribution tarball, if any. -# -# 5. Fall back to a fixed timestamp. -# -# Once the value of SOURCE_DATE_EPOCH is determined, it is stored in the recipe's SDE_FILE. -# If none of these mechanisms are suitable, replace the do_deploy_source_date_epoch task -# with recipe-specific functionality to write the appropriate SOURCE_DATE_EPOCH into the SDE_FILE. -# -# If this file is found by other tasks, the value is exported in the SOURCE_DATE_EPOCH variable. -# SOURCE_DATE_EPOCH is set for all tasks that might use it (do_configure, do_compile, do_package, ...) - -BUILD_REPRODUCIBLE_BINARIES ??= '1' -inherit ${@oe.utils.ifelse(d.getVar('BUILD_REPRODUCIBLE_BINARIES') == '1', 'reproducible_build_simple', '')} - -SDE_DIR ="${WORKDIR}/source-date-epoch" -SDE_FILE = "${SDE_DIR}/__source_date_epoch.txt" - -SSTATETASKS += "do_deploy_source_date_epoch" - -do_deploy_source_date_epoch () { - echo "Deploying SDE to ${SDE_DIR}." -} - -python do_deploy_source_date_epoch_setscene () { - sstate_setscene(d) -} - -do_deploy_source_date_epoch[dirs] = "${SDE_DIR}" -do_deploy_source_date_epoch[sstate-plaindirs] = "${SDE_DIR}" -addtask do_deploy_source_date_epoch_setscene -addtask do_deploy_source_date_epoch before do_configure after do_patch - -def get_source_date_epoch_from_known_files(d, sourcedir): - source_date_epoch = None - newest_file = None - known_files = set(["NEWS", "ChangeLog", "Changelog", "CHANGES"]) - for file in known_files: - filepath = os.path.join(sourcedir, file) - if os.path.isfile(filepath): - mtime = int(os.lstat(filepath).st_mtime) - # There may be more than one "known_file" present, if so, use the youngest one - if not source_date_epoch or mtime > source_date_epoch: - source_date_epoch = mtime - newest_file = filepath - if newest_file: - bb.debug(1, "SOURCE_DATE_EPOCH taken from: %s" % newest_file) - return source_date_epoch - -def find_git_folder(d, sourcedir): - # First guess: WORKDIR/git - # This is the default git fetcher unpack path - workdir = d.getVar('WORKDIR') - gitpath = os.path.join(workdir, "git/.git") - if os.path.isdir(gitpath): - return gitpath - - # Second guess: ${S} - gitpath = os.path.join(sourcedir, ".git") - if os.path.isdir(gitpath): - return gitpath - - # Perhaps there was a subpath or destsuffix specified. - # Go looking in the WORKDIR - exclude = set(["build", "image", "license-destdir", "patches", "pseudo", - "recipe-sysroot", "recipe-sysroot-native", "sysroot-destdir", "temp"]) - for root, dirs, files in os.walk(workdir, topdown=True): - dirs[:] = [d for d in dirs if d not in exclude] - if '.git' in dirs: - return root - - bb.warn("Failed to find a git repository in WORKDIR: %s" % workdir) - return None - -def get_source_date_epoch_from_git(d, sourcedir): - source_date_epoch = None - if "git://" in d.getVar('SRC_URI'): - gitpath = find_git_folder(d, sourcedir) - if gitpath: - import subprocess - source_date_epoch = int(subprocess.check_output(['git','log','-1','--pretty=%ct'], cwd=gitpath)) - bb.debug(1, "git repository: %s" % gitpath) - return source_date_epoch - -def get_source_date_epoch_from_youngest_file(d, sourcedir): - if sourcedir == d.getVar('WORKDIR'): - # These sources are almost certainly not from a tarball - return None - - # Do it the hard way: check all files and find the youngest one... - source_date_epoch = None - newest_file = None - for root, dirs, files in os.walk(sourcedir, topdown=True): - files = [f for f in files if not f[0] == '.'] - - for fname in files: - filename = os.path.join(root, fname) - try: - mtime = int(os.lstat(filename).st_mtime) - except ValueError: - mtime = 0 - if not source_date_epoch or mtime > source_date_epoch: - source_date_epoch = mtime - newest_file = filename - - if newest_file: - bb.debug(1, "Newest file found: %s" % newest_file) - return source_date_epoch - -def fixed_source_date_epoch(): - bb.debug(1, "No tarball or git repo found to determine SOURCE_DATE_EPOCH") - return 0 - -python do_create_source_date_epoch_stamp() { - epochfile = d.getVar('SDE_FILE') - if os.path.isfile(epochfile): - bb.debug(1, "Reusing SOURCE_DATE_EPOCH from: %s" % epochfile) - return - - sourcedir = d.getVar('S') - source_date_epoch = ( - get_source_date_epoch_from_git(d, sourcedir) or - get_source_date_epoch_from_known_files(d, sourcedir) or - get_source_date_epoch_from_youngest_file(d, sourcedir) or - fixed_source_date_epoch() # Last resort - ) - - bb.debug(1, "SOURCE_DATE_EPOCH: %d" % source_date_epoch) - bb.utils.mkdirhier(d.getVar('SDE_DIR')) - with open(epochfile, 'w') as f: - f.write(str(source_date_epoch)) -} - -BB_HASHBASE_WHITELIST += "SOURCE_DATE_EPOCH" - -python () { - if d.getVar('BUILD_REPRODUCIBLE_BINARIES') == '1': - d.appendVarFlag("do_unpack", "postfuncs", " do_create_source_date_epoch_stamp") - epochfile = d.getVar('SDE_FILE') - source_date_epoch = "0" - if os.path.isfile(epochfile): - with open(epochfile, 'r') as f: - source_date_epoch = f.read() - bb.debug(1, "SOURCE_DATE_EPOCH: %s" % source_date_epoch) - d.setVar('SOURCE_DATE_EPOCH', source_date_epoch) -} |
